Robert Wyland (Born 1956) American, Signed Seascape Lithograph. Depicts two killer whales in his signature style with sunlight beaming down into the dark waters from above, and the lined bottom of the sea with a handful of shells bathed in an eerie green glow. Signed and dated 1999 within the print near the bottom left edge of the rounded image. Signed and numbered 923/2000 in pencil bottom left outside the image in the square frame.
Size: 20 x 18 1/2 x 1 in.
Sight Size: 17 1/2 x 17 1/2 in.
Robert Wyland was born in Detroit, Michigan in 1956. He is active/lives in California, and is known for his lusciously detailed marine life seascapes, as well as his Whaling Wall public art mural. He attended the Center for Creative Studies in Detroit, majoring in painting and sculpture. Upon graduation his professors Jay Holland, Russell Keeter, and Bill Gerard recognized his talent and encouraged him to move to the California coast where he could further develop his art. Wyland, who paints in watercolors and oils, celebrates underwater sea life in his paintings and bronze sculptures. He is also known for his conservation efforts. In 1981 after being frustrated by his attempts to capture whales on canvas he painted his first public art titled, Whaling Wall. After garnering media attention for the artwork he embarked on a quest to complete 100 Whaling Walls by 2011 to raise public awareness of sea life, with the final piece being painted at the Beijing Olympics in 2008 when he was the official artist for the United State Team. In 1993 he founded the Wyland Foundation to promote and protect ocean resources through life-sized public art, educational programs and support for environmental groups. In 1998 the United Nations proclaimed him the official artist for the International Year of the Ocean.
